If Bangaru Telangana matters, then sign the affidavit for the youth: Sharmila challenges KCR

YS Sharmila challenged Telangana Chief Minister K Chandrashekar Rao to sign the affidavit she released on his behalf yesterday in a message she sent to him on Wednesday. Sharmila asked KCR to sign the document and release his promise on Twitter if he had truly cared for the state's youth and students.
“If Bangaru Telangana matters, then lend your golden signature for the sake of the golden future of the students. They are distressed and distraught with an uncertain future. Your signature on this affidavit makes it clear that you will conduct TSPSC exams in an efficient and fair manner. We demand that you assure the state that there won’t be any more paper leakages in Telangana,” she tweeted, adding, for a person who claimed to have read more than 80000 books and striving for the changing of the Constitution, it is easy to realise the power of an affidavit signed by none other than the chief minister of a state.
The affidavit contained a guarantee that there will be no cheating or leaks throughout the exam. The chief minister's apology to the state, taking responsibility for the TSPSC exam papers' leak, was also included.
